Glean

  • +Best-in-class unified, permission-enforced index across many apps with citation-grounded answers
  • +Genuinely model-agnostic and open: MCP host plus server, bring-your-own model, and on-prem deployment
  • +One governed platform spanning search, assistant, and agents with built-in certification and monitoring
  • -Opaque, expensive pricing with high seat minimums and add-on fees; reported fully-loaded deployments run into the hundreds of thousands
  • -The autonomous-agents marketing outpaces demonstrated autonomy; in practice agents are supervised

Microsoft Copilot

  • +Deepest integration into tools people already live in, grounded in org data via Microsoft Graph
  • +A genuine agent platform with open MCP and A2A interop and multi-model choice (OpenAI, Anthropic, in-house)
  • +Enterprise-grade controls, with licensed-user agent usage zero-rated in M365 apps
  • -Layered, confusing pricing: the $30 seat is an add-on on top of a base license, and agents bill in separate credits that were renamed in 2025
  • -The flagship in-app experience is assistant/copilot, not autonomous, so agent marketing can overstate it
